Gyusun
02629da9ca
Generate Sources of master updated at Wed Feb 12 00:01:18 GMT 2020
2020-02-12 00:01:18 +00:00
Gyusun Yeom
d1d8b889b8
Fix #25 make scheduled jobs always run. Even though nothing changed
2020-01-30 22:20:03 +09:00
Gyusun
3871202dfd
Merge https://github.com/nigels-com/glew.git into master HEAD at Tue Jan 28 13:32:34 GMT 2020
2020-01-28 13:32:34 +00:00
Nigel Stewart
83a174e575
Fixup TOC for README.md
2020-01-27 10:46:14 +10:00
Nigel Stewart
7c706576b8
Add TOC to README.md
2020-01-27 10:44:14 +10:00
Gyusun
c32bb089c1
Generate Sources of master updated at Tue Jan 21 22:56:03 GMT 2020
2020-01-21 22:56:03 +00:00
Gyusun
83907238d9
Merge https://github.com/nigels-com/glew.git into master HEAD at Tue Jan 21 22:55:43 GMT 2020
2020-01-21 22:55:43 +00:00
Nigel Stewart
82e8441253
GLEW 2.2.0 RC3 snapshot added
2020-01-18 10:39:33 +10:00
Nigel Stewart
18676f16d9
GL_EXT_semaphore constants fix (Issue #249 )
2019-12-23 08:56:49 +10:00
Gyusun
59a52e570f
Generate Sources of master updated at Mon Nov 11 00:03:55 GMT 2019
2019-11-11 00:03:55 +00:00
Gyusun
f9b0c4225f
Merge https://github.com/nigels-com/glew.git into master HEAD at Mon Nov 11 00:03:32 GMT 2019
2019-11-11 00:03:32 +00:00
Nigel Stewart
262514e123
glStencilFuncSeparate parameter name correction based on gl.xml (Issue #243 )
2019-11-03 22:29:57 +10:00
Gyusun Yeom
6f770a5b5b
Merge branch 'feature/pkgconfig'
2019-10-09 20:42:36 +09:00
Gyusun Yeom
4f2237a265
Generate pkg-config file
2019-10-09 20:40:50 +09:00
Gyusun Yeom
cc5cfff738
Cleanup CMakeLists
2019-10-09 20:40:25 +09:00
Gyusun
5a59fc7d94
Generate Sources of master updated at Sat Oct 5 09:11:53 GMT 2019
2019-10-05 09:11:53 +00:00
Gyusun
59c63684ee
Merge https://github.com/nigels-com/glew.git into master HEAD at Sat Oct 5 09:11:32 GMT 2019
2019-10-05 09:11:32 +00:00
Nigel Stewart
d47097985a
README.md touch-up - Travis index.html no longer available
2019-09-28 13:37:35 +10:00
Nigel Stewart
17761407da
README.md touch-up
2019-09-28 13:32:45 +10:00
Nigel Stewart
2ed67686ba
Updated README.md with mention of fresh snapshot (2.2.0 RC2)
2019-09-28 13:31:40 +10:00
Nigel Stewart
4bbe8aa2ab
Visual Studio 16 release-mode cmake fixup: libvcruntime.lib, msvcrt.lib
2019-09-28 12:27:53 +10:00
Nigel Stewart
68135131a9
Resolve visualinfo and glewinfo link warnings for vc15 build
2019-09-28 11:54:27 +10:00
Nigel Stewart
b374d9ad93
Fix vc15 release build memset link problem for v142 toolchains
2019-09-28 11:45:01 +10:00
Nigel Stewart
0831041e9f
Refinements for SYSTEM=msys builds (MSYS2)
2019-09-27 23:55:50 +10:00
Nigel Stewart
3f91cd177a
For SYSTEM=msys put dll in bin directory
2019-09-27 23:32:44 +10:00
Nigel Stewart
5509e2e13e
Resolve gcc -Wshadow / MS C4456 compilation warning(s)
2019-09-27 22:08:15 +10:00
Gyusun Yeom
20ea2d0d07
Move to azure pipeline
2019-09-23 00:12:27 +09:00
Gyusun Yeom
ceb7145f3e
Generate Sources of master updated at Wed Sep 18 13:43:07 GMT 2019
2019-09-18 22:43:07 +09:00
Bluenaxela
371895de42
Add proper support for static builds on WIN32
2019-09-18 22:40:54 +09:00
Gyusun Yeom
acd5fc7f64
fix windows build error - add rc files
2019-09-18 21:57:34 +09:00
Gyusun Yeom
708bbfd807
Generate Sources of master updated at 2019. 09. 15. (일) 15:14:15 GMT
2019-09-16 00:14:15 +09:00
Gyusun Yeom
df23003353
Fix importing tags - use proper registry
2019-09-16 00:13:34 +09:00
Gyusun Yeom
41c88953cd
Merge https://github.com/nigels-com/glew.git into master HEAD at Mon Aug 19 14:31:27 GMT 2019
2019-08-19 14:31:27 +00:00
Nigel Stewart
ea30c83d92
linux-clang: -std=c89 rather than -ansi
2019-08-19 22:46:06 +10:00
Nigel Stewart
9170611428
Travis: Use Xenial for build coverage
2019-08-19 22:43:44 +10:00
Gyusun Yeom
77fa1efe71
Generate Sources of master updated at Thu Aug 8 14:37:32 GMT 2019
2019-08-08 14:37:32 +00:00
Gyusun Yeom
1f730ccb3d
Generate Sources of master updated at Mon Jul 29 14:35:28 GMT 2019
2019-07-29 14:35:28 +00:00
Gyusun Yeom
2545ef4e02
Fix error and typo in maintain script
2019-07-01 00:51:33 +09:00
Gyusun Yeom
5bc4c9d380
Generate Sources of master updated at Sun Jun 30 14:34:29 GMT 2019
2019-06-30 14:34:29 +00:00
Gyusun Yeom
ff01f1db86
Merge https://github.com/nigels-com/glew.git into master HEAD at Sun Jun 30 14:31:55 GMT 2019
2019-06-30 14:31:55 +00:00
Gyusun Yeom
0329c64675
Fix CI error
2019-06-30 11:04:15 +09:00
Gyusun Yeom
e3f3079a53
Add CI pipeline data
2019-06-29 18:51:17 +09:00
Gyusun Yeom
c52a9eb978
Move maintain script into own directory
2019-06-29 18:28:31 +09:00
Nigel Stewart
47588720ee
Extend GLEW_INCLUDE support to eglew.h and glxew.h
2019-06-13 09:28:51 +10:00
ArthurSonzogni
8c42082242
Fix cmake error on Linux "no LIBRARY DESTINATION"
...
On Linux, cmake gives the error:
~~~bash
CMake Error at CMakeLists.txt:79 (INSTALL):
INSTALL TARGETS given no LIBRARY DESTINATION for shared library target
"libglew_shared".
CMake Error at CMakeLists.txt:94 (INSTALL):
INSTALL TARGETS given no LIBRARY DESTINATION for shared library target
"libglewmx_shared".
-- Configuring incomplete, errors occurred!
~~~
This bug was caused by the merge:
e4de8a77a1
Containing:
* Update library install directories in Cmake
commit 5a7232fc53
* Install directories set in single statement
commit def19e7de4
The cause is that RUNTIME DESTINATION is now defined (for Windows), but
not LIBRARY DESTINATION (for Linux).
See issue: https://github.com/Perlmint/glew-cmake/issues/17
2019-06-11 21:37:30 +09:00
Gyusun Yeom
662a645508
Merge https://github.com/nigels-com/glew.git into master HEAD at Wed Apr 24 02:44:14 GMT 2019
2019-04-24 02:44:14 +00:00
Stefan Zabka
154f83e024
Made build description a bit clearer
...
I hope this version is more understandable for people just reading the Readme
I had to go read #13 first to understand what this meant.
2019-04-23 23:03:53 +10:00
Gyusun Yeom
e4de8a77a1
Merge pull request #16 from GekkieHenkie/patch-1
...
Update library install directories in Cmake
2019-04-20 15:45:09 +09:00
GekkieHenkie
5a7232fc53
Install directories set in single statement
2019-04-09 23:59:48 +02:00
GekkieHenkie
def19e7de4
Update library install directories in Cmake
...
Currently (well, at least on Windows), the created DLL files aren't installed to the correct directory after a build. The DLL files are installed to the 'lib' directory. Which actually is the place for the static library or the shared library's symbols file (.lib).
The shared library runtimes should be installed to the 'bin' output directory, as proposed in this PR.
See the ```CONFIGURATIONS``` option in [Install command introduction in the CMake manual](https://cmake.org/cmake/help/v3.14/command/install.html#introduction ) for an example.
It's considered best practice and follows convention as used in other notable libraries as libpng, libogg/vorbis, freetype, zlib, tinyxml, etc, to install the runtime output in the 'bin' directory.
2019-04-09 23:22:16 +02:00